MORAGA, Calif. — A furious beginning only foreshadowed a thrilling end Thursday afternoon, as the Saint Mary’s men’s soccer team was narrowly defeated by Pac-12 member Washington in its home opener, 2-1, at Saint Mary’s Stadium.
Both teams scored goals within the first 10 minutes of the match, making a 0-0 game quickly into 1-1 and proving both squads had the capability to beat the other. They then held each other scoreless for the next 77 minutes before the Huskies (1-1) got the eventual game-winner from Handwalla Bwana in the 87th minute.
Bwana moved forward on an attack with David Coly and Scott Menzies.
